On Saturday 6th February it was an early start to the weekend for 17 Year 11 students who spent the day selling their wears at McArthur Glen Shopping centre in York. The day started at 8.30am when the 3 Brayton College Young Enterprise groups had to begin setting up their trade stalls. There was lots of creativity on display as each group got into the idea of promoting their product in the best possible way.
Customers began to arrive at the shopping centre at 10.00am and after initial nerves approaching strangers the Year 11 students soon got into the idea of Customer Service. We had Valentine chocolates being sold and student providing taster opportunities for potential customers; we had personalised tie dyed underwear being sold and students wearing these to promote the product; finally we had bracelets being made and sold. The students staffed their stalls for the whole day and eventually finished trading at 4pm. Despite being extremely tired everyone had a fantastic day - each group made lots of sales and had many happy customers.
